Ferit Edgü (1936–2024)

Ferit Edgü, a beloved writer and publisher of Turkish literature, has died at the age of 88. A novella and a collection of short stories by Edgü, The Wounded Age and Eastern Tales (trans. Aron Aji), was published in a single volume by NYRB Classics in 2023 and was named a finalist for the EBRD Literature Prize. Maya Jaggi, a judge for the prize, said of the volume, “The Wounded Age and Eastern Tales ... bear witness with poetry and horror to a nightmarish history of state violence in eastern Türkiye and an often forgotten people.”
